Can You Get High From Smoking Hemp? Now You Can With Boston Hemp's THCa Bud

Boston Hemp Inc. launched THCa, a new hemp strain. THCa is reported to have similar effects as smoking cannabis. The major difference is, cannabis is not legal in many states and THCa is. Because it is hemp, it falls under federal law.

THCa flower is cannabis that falls under the Federal Farm Bill of 2018 signed into law by former president Donald J. Trump. In this bill, hemp is legal as long as THC 9 levels in the plant test below .3%. In order for psychoactive effects to take place the THCa flower must be smoked producing a high quintessentially the same as traditional marijuana.

These particular flowers are high in THCa (tetrahydrocannabinolic acid) and extremely low in concentration of traditional THC (d9 below 0.3%) registering the bud farm bill compliant. Once THCa is decarboxylated (smoked) it is recognized by the body as traditional THC producing a similar psychoactive effect indistinguishable from marijuana.

THCa is genetically and naturally produced and not a synthetic alternative like it's counterpart Delta 8.
